EU Nations Agree to Freeze Russian Assets Worth €210bn for Ukraine Aid
European Union member states have consented to the indefinite freezing of Russian assets totalling up to €210 billion, a measure taken in response to Russia's ongoing military aggression against Ukraine. The majority of these assets are currently held with Belgium’s Euroclear bank. There is anticipation among European leaders for an agreement at the forthcoming crucial EU summit, which aims to utilise the frozen funds through a loan to support both the military efforts and the economic stability of Ukraine.

Since the commencement of Russia's comprehensive warfare nearly four years ago, Ukraine finds itself in dire financial straits, requiring an estimated €135.7 billion to sustain itself over the next couple of years. The EU seeks to contribute two-thirds of this amount, a proposal that has drawn ire from Russian officials who label it as an act of theft.
In a retaliatory move, the Russian Central Bank launched a lawsuit against Euroclear in a Moscow court, challenging the EU's loan strategy. This legal action underlines the escalating tensions between the EU and Russia over the asset freeze initiative.
The rationale behind the EU’s proposal is to utilise Russia’s frozen funds towards the reconstruction of Ukraine, recognising these assets as compensation for the destruction wrought by the Russian forces. German Chancellor Friedrich Merz articulated that this move would significantly bolster Ukraine’s defences against any future Russian hostilities.
However, this proposition has not been without controversy. Belgium, where Euroclear is based, exhibits apprehension about potential financial repercussions and the broader implications for the global financial system as articulated by Euroclear CEO Valérie Urbain. There exists a heightened concern over the legal and economic consequences that might ensue from such an unprecedented action.
In the meantime, the EU is racing against time to forge a compromise acceptable to Belgium in advance of the pivotal summit. A notable aspect of the EU’s approach involves leveraging the “windfall profits” derived from these assets to fund Ukraine, a move considered legally safe given the sanctions imposed on Russia.
Amidst dwindling international military aid for Ukraine, especially from the United States under President Donald Trump, the EU faces the challenge of addressing the financial gap. Proposals include capital market fundraising backed by the EU budget and direct lending using the immobilised Russian assets to secure the necessary €90 billion for Ukraine.
Belgium, under the leadership of Prime Minister Bart De Wever, calls for “rational, reasonable, and justified conditions” before endorsing the EU's reparations plan. De Wever’s stance reflects Belgium's careful navigation through the legal and economic pitfalls associated with the initiative, underscoring the country's dedication to supporting Ukraine while safeguarding its own interests.
